Transaction fb81dfd030f3d7fd8fee81e964996a62ef50545fc2f16d1e6cd89247778a152d
1 Input
1 Output
-
fb81dfd030f3d7fd8fee81e964996a62ef50545fc2f16d1e6cd89247778a152d:0
- value
- 21904
- script pubkey
- OP_0 OP_PUSHBYTES_32 8838dcc4df53d93fca8f7531f0e677742f53e6daace37e4e58b1fb8c3395e6ef
- address
- bc1q3qude3xl20vnlj50w5clpenhwsh48ek64n3hunjck8accvu4umhsvd006a